In conventional apposition eyes, the receptive rod (rhabdom) acts as a detector that measures the average brightness of a small region of space, typically about 1 across. The angle between adjacent rhabdomeres within a single ommatidium (the acceptance angle) is similar to the angle between adjacent ommatidia (the inter-ommatidial angle), giving the eye a continuous field of view with areas of overlap between neighboring ommatidia;[2]:1612 the advantage of this arrangement is that the same visual axis is sampled from a larger area of the eye, increasing overall sensitivity by a factor of seven, without increasing the size of the eye or reducing its acuity. For example, in the honeybee there are three photopigments in each ommatidium, with maximum sensitivities in the ultraviolet, the blue, and the green regions of the spectrum. The number of ommatidia in the eye depends upon the type of arthropod and range from as low as 5 as in the Antarctic isopod Glyptonotus antarcticus,[3] or a handful in the primitive Zygentoma, to around 30,000 in larger Anisoptera dragonflies and some Sphingidae moths.[4]. The typical apposition eye has a lens focusing light from one direction on the rhabdom, while light from other directions is absorbed by the dark wall of the ommatidium. The size of the ommatidia varies according to species, but ranges from 5 to 50 micrometres.
